What Testyra Is
Traditional cognitive assessments — the kind used in research settings or clinical practice — are often expensive, require professional administration, or both. Testyra was built on a straightforward premise: cognitive assessment grounded in established psychology research should be accessible to anyone with a browser.
Each test targets a specific cognitive process. Reaction time. Working memory capacity. Inhibitory control. Divergent thinking. Logical reasoning. Tests are performance based where possible, scored against clear criteria, and each result includes a plain language explanation of what it may suggest alongside its limitations.
The tests are designed around published research frameworks in cognitive psychology. That does not make them clinical tools — they are not, and that distinction is important — but it means the measurements are grounded in something real rather than invented for engagement.

What We Stand For
Accessibility. Cognitive assessment should not require money, professional referrals, or academic access. Every test on Testyra is free and designed to be usable without prior knowledge of psychology.
Accuracy over confidence. Where research is contested or measurements have known limitations, we say so clearly. The Methodology page documents this in full. A test that overstates what it can tell you is not useful — it is just flattering.
Honest scope. Testyra is a self exploration and personal development platform. It is not a clinical tool, a diagnostic service, or a replacement for professional assessment. Results are starting points for reflection, not definitive measurements of ability.
Practical improvement. Specific cognitive skills respond to deliberate practice. That is reasonably well supported in research for abilities like working memory, reaction speed, and reasoning. Making targeted practice accessible and worth returning to is the practical design goal behind each test category.
